The National Chamber for Italian Fashion, also known as Camera Nazionale della Moda Italiana, is a non-profit organization based in Italy. Founded in 1958 with approximately 70 employees, the organization's purpose is the promotion and coordination of the Italian fashion industry, along with the training of young Italian designers. It is recognized as the organizer of Milan Fashion Week, which is considered one of the four major global fashion weeks alongside events in New York, Paris, and London.
